Search

See All Group Directory in Greenwood, IN

Eye Surgeons of Indiana PC

Optometry
Ophthalmology
5 Providers
533 E County Line Rd Ste 210 Greenwood, IN

Make an Appointment

(317) 841-2020

Telehealth services available

Eye Surgeons of Indiana PC is a medical group practice located in Greenwood, IN. This practice specializes in Optometry and Ophthalmology.

Providers

Insurance Check
Search for your insurance provider
Please double-check when making an appointment.
Medical Services
Search for your condition or procedure
Please double-check when making an appointment.

Frequently Asked Questions

Eye Surgeons of Indiana PC is located at 533 E County Line Rd Ste 210, Greenwood, IN 46143.

Providers at Eye Surgeons of Indiana PC specialize in Optometry and Ophthalmology.

Five providers practice at Eye Surgeons of Indiana PC.

Use the insurance check on this page to verify if Eye Surgeons of Indiana PC is in-network.

Locations

  1. Office

    1. 1
      533 E County Line Rd Ste 210, Greenwood, IN 46143 Directions (317) 841-2020